Tri-Valley Maroon scored all their runs in one inning and then held off Tea-P for an 8-7 road win on Tuesday, June 21st.

Tea-P got on the board first with a run in the bottom of the first inning.  They added two more in the bottom of the third and led 3-0 after three innings of play.

Tri-Valley Maroon then had their big eight-run inning in the top of the fourth.  Gage Egger drove home the first run with a single.  Egger then scored on a passed ball.  Treyson Ricther tied the game when he scored on a passed ball.  Dylan Christensen followed with an RBI single.  Parker Atwood and Denton Bicknase both had RBI singles.  Both Cole Hendrixson and Mason Hemme reached on errors that also scored runs to give Tri-Valley an 8-3 lead.

Tea-P put together a late rally.  They scored a run in the bottom of the fifth to make the score 8-4.  They then got the bases loaded with one out after three straight walks.  A strikeout followed leaving the bases loaded with two outs.  Another walk brought home one run, then a single added two more runs to make the score 8-7.  Tri-Valley, however, got a ground out of the next better to end the game and leave the tying run on third base.

Bicknase had two hits with an RBI.  Egger, Christensen, and Atwood all had a single and an RBI.  M. Hemme and Parker Hemme both had a single.  Egger pitched two innings and allowed an unearned run on three hits and a walk with two strikeouts.  Bicknase also pitched two innings and allowed two runs, one earned, on a hit with one strikeout.  Jackson Williams pitched 1 2/3 innings and allowed four runs, three earned, on a hit and five walks with a strikeout.  Hendrixson pitched 1/3 of an inning.
